Subject: [PATCH 0/2] config: make config_with_options() handle any repo
Date: Mon, 26 Aug 2019 20:57:26 -0300	[thread overview]
Message-ID: <cover.1566863604.git.matheus.bernardino@usp.br> (raw)

This patchset makes more config.c functions handle arbitrary repos and
use that to remove an add_to_alternates_memory() call in
submodule-config.c. This should hopefully benefit performance and
memory.

Matheus Tavares (2):
  config: allow config_with_options() to handle any repo
  submodule: pass repo instead of adding to alternates list
